The passenger car segment holds a significant share in the integrated booster seat market. Integrated booster seats are designed to ensure the safety and comfort of children during car travel. These booster seats are embedded within the vehicle’s seating system, providing a seamless and convenient solution for parents and caregivers. Unlike traditional booster seats, which can be bulky and require installation, integrated booster seats are built into the vehicle, offering a more space-efficient option.
As the demand for child safety products grows, automakers are increasingly incorporating integrated booster seats into their designs to meet safety regulations and consumer preferences. These seats provide an added layer of protection by positioning children at the correct height for seat belts to function effectively, reducing the risk of injury in the event of a collision. The convenience of built-in booster seats also appeals to parents who prefer an integrated solution that does not require extra installations or adjustments during travel.

1. What is an integrated booster seat?
An integrated booster seat is a child safety seat that is built directly into the vehicle's seating system, providing convenience and enhanced protection for passengers.
2. Why are integrated booster seats important in vehicles?
Integrated booster seats are crucial for ensuring that children and smaller passengers are properly positioned to use the vehicle's seatbelt effectively, improving safety during travel.
3. How does an integrated booster seat differ from traditional booster seats?
Unlike traditional booster seats, which are separate and need to be installed, integrated booster seats are built into the vehicle’s seat, offering convenience and saving space.
4. Are integrated booster seats only for children?
While primarily designed for children, integrated booster seats can also benefit smaller adults or individuals with special needs who require additional support in maintaining proper seatbelt positioning.
5. What safety regulations apply to integrated booster seats?
Integrated booster seats must meet national and international safety standards, including those set by organizations like the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) and the European Union regulations for child safety seats.
6. Are integrated booster seats compatible with all vehicles?
Not all vehicles are designed to accommodate integrated booster seats; compatibility depends on the vehicle's make and model, as well as its seating configuration.
